Silica Micro Powder: The Hidden “Blood” of the Chip Industry

Silica micro powder is a high-performance inorganic non-metallic functional material. It comes mainly from natural quartz or fused quartz. It undergoes precision processes. These include crushing, classification, grinding, magnetic separation, flotation, and acid washing. The result is a fine, high-purity powder. It has small particle size and stable chemical properties. It offers excellent dielectric performance.

How to Control Each Step in Spherical Silicon Micropowder Production ?

Spherical silicon micropowder has high purity, ultra-fine particles, excellent dielectric and thermal conductivity properties, and a low coefficient of thermal expansion. It finds wide applications in large-scale integrated circuit packaging, aerospace, coatings, pharmaceuticals, and daily-use cosmetics, making it an irreplaceable filler. Ultrafine Silica Powder Production Technology

Silica powder is primarily made from natural quartz or fused quartz. It undergoes a series of meticulous processes, including crushing, grading, grinding, magnetic separation, flotation, and pickling. With the rapid development of high-tech industries such as electronics, 5G, semiconductors, and photovoltaics, the demand for silica powder is growing.
